## Overview

The PetSafe Busy Buddy Tug-A-Jug is a durable, interactive treat-dispensing toy designed for small dogs (10-40 lbs). It holds up to 3.5 cups of kibble, features a patented Treat Meter for random treat release, and includes a braided rope for tug-of-war and dental benefits. Dishwasher safe and customizable treat flow make it a versatile slow feeder and trainer trusted by pet owners since 1998.

## Customer Reviews

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 HIGH level of difficulty
*by J***N on August 4, 2026*

This treat dispenser has a very high level of difficulty but great if your dog has figured out others too easily. It’s not as durable as I’d like (the first one cracked) but it’s the only treat toy I’ve found that takes a long time to empty. It’s easy to load with kibble and requires a lot of effort and focus from my dog. I have two dogs—the beauty and the brains. One hasn’t figured it out and has given up while the other took a few hours with some coaching. Now that she’s cracked the code, it still takes a good 15-20 minutes to retrieve a half cup of kibble. While it’s a bit expensive for a plastic canister and a rope, it’s been worth it since the other toys I’ve tried lasted my girl 2-3 minutes. And it’s totally safe unsupervised (but fun to watch when they get it)! I wouldn’t suggest for really small dogs because of the size and weight. If your dog can’t figure it out, you could always cut the rope out and see if they can flip it around to get the treats out of the nozzle. I can’t emphasize enough this is a highly challenging product.

###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 The return of a classic!
*by V***L on May 12, 2019*

We were so excited to get this Tug-A-Jug! Veronica had one years ago, and it lasted quite awhile, but eventually the base cracked and it wouldn't screw shut. Veronica had developed a very efficient system in which she picks the jug up from the bottom, holds it upside down while at the same time stepping on the rope. This causes the kibble to fly out of the jug. Unfortunately years of gripping the end of the jug took it's toll. Our second Tug-A-Jug was just plain weird. For awhile they were replacing the rope with a rubber *rope*. It totally didn't work for Veronica and she hated it. Just recently I saw the Tug-A-Jug here on Amazon and it looked like the original design - with an actual *rope* made of rope (and yes, it is). It didn't take Veronica long at all to remember her old technique. Despite that she is a bit of a whiz at food puzzles (as most slightly overweight, extremely food motivated, convinced they are in a perpetual state of starvation, dogs tend to be); the Tug-A-Jug does slow Veronica down some and makes mealtime more of an "event" as opposed to over before I turn around from putting her kibble back in the cabinet. We love the Tug-A-Jug, reasonably sturdy and well made and a ton of fun. The sizing however is way off, and I first ordered the medium/large for dogs over 40 pounds because Veronica is 55 pounds and I didn't remember the size of our original toy. The medium/large is ginormous. Even with the small, Veronica's kibble dinner doesn't fill 1/4 of it (full disclosure, she also gets breakfast, lunch and snacks in addition to dinner - so we are not by any stretch of the imagination starving her). Still the small is plenty big enough. The mediem/large would have been too unwieldy for her. I had no problem at all exchanging my medium/large for the small.
